Source: US Section of Protection. China’s navy strategists see a blockade as a strategy that provides them versatility to tighten or loosen a noose close to Taiwan, based upon Beijing’s aims. China could impose a restricted blockade by stopping and screening ships, with out attacking Taiwan’s ports. Offered Taiwan’s dependence on imports of gas and food, even A short lived blockade could shock the island politically and economically, allowing for China a forceful way to push its requires. “This causes it to be probable to start out and cease when Taiwan ‘learns its lesson,’” reported Phillip C. Taiwan’s geography leaves it vulnerable to a blockade. Its population, marketplace and ports are concentrated on its western flank, closest to China.

China gained Command there within the late seventeenth century and ruled Taiwan for some two hundreds of years. Japan acquired Taiwan in 1895 subsequent the first Sino-Japanese War, and it grew to become a colony.

China could impose a blockade, by sending ships and submarines to prevent vessels from moving into or leaving Taiwan’s ports. It could use warplanes and missiles to dominate the skies.
